Aunc.1672 net.general utzoo!decvax!duke!unc!smb Fri Jan 8 13:07:59 1982 AT&T settles with Government AT&T and the U.S. government have settled their seven-year-old anti-trust suit out of court. Under the terms of the settlement, AT&T will divest itself of the local operating companies; it will retain AT&T Long Lines (the long distance service), Western Electric, and Bell Labs. The reorganization will be completed within 18 months. In the meantime, trading in IBM stock has been suspended pending a 3pm meeting in U.S. District Court. Sources say that a major announce- ment is pending, but no one will disclose just what it is.
